Q1.
An example of a situation when a person uses emotional intelligence to resolve a complicated
situation is portrayed by Colin Shaw. Years ago, the director of the client experience at BT
Major Business, Colin Shaw applied emotional intelligence to maximize productivity and
performance in the face of adversity. At the time, BT Company was facing several challenges.
The firm was losing clients and customers were becoming increasingly dissatisfied. It also found
that the company`s customer service advisors spent only about a fifth of their time dealing with
their clients, (Shim, J). The rest of the time dedicated to processing and administration due to the
shortage of personnel. As a result, the director identified the need for change.
Firstly, Colin Shaw recognized that it was fundamental to build long-term robust relationships
with clients through engaging with consumers at an emotional level. Thus, to heighten client
